Output ab26e33abeb83fa8c44986603f6e6f875cbebc8e330b51fc0bca8fa7be1933bb:0

value
12756322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f8045e79d602adbf6060ea6ece14b9180c29d3e OP_EQUAL
address
3BrabQVEsq9ewCvG4CGF5rUjePHwQ3g4et
transaction
ab26e33abeb83fa8c44986603f6e6f875cbebc8e330b51fc0bca8fa7be1933bb
confirmations
174908
spent
true